Hey LeoNinja22, this is a super interesting topic! I’ve been thinking a lot about the idea of linking specialized platforms that usually operate in silos. What if we connected tools like interactive simulations (think PhET) directly with lessons on Google Classroom? Imagine students being able to jump right into a simulation based on the lesson plan they’re studying and then easily share their findings. That could spark deeper engagement and maybe even enhance concept retention.

Also, pairing data tracking tools with learning management software could let teachers identify student learning patterns in real time and tailor their support. While I appreciate the discussion, I see several areas where additional integration could amplify learning. My experience suggests that merging open-source coding platforms with mainstream learning management systems could significantly benefit both educators and students. For instance, when lesson plans are linked with interactive coding environments, it simplifies the application of complex topics through experimentation and immediate feedback. Coupling these tools with real-time assessment metrics not only enhances understanding but also adapts learning paths effectively for diverse student needs. Such connectivity could drive educational improvements across different disciplines.
